全双工和半双工的区别_终于有人能把“串行通信和并行通信”的区别分析得清清楚楚了...

本文详细介绍了串行通信和并行通信的区别,包括数据传输方式、应用场景及各自的优缺点。同时,还探讨了串行通信中的同步与异步协议,以及其在嵌入式系统中的应用。
部署运行你感兴趣的模型镜像

在串行通信中,数据是二进制脉冲的形式。换句话说,我们可以说二进制1表示逻辑高电平或5伏特,零表示逻辑低电平或0伏特。串行通信可以采用多种形式,具体取决于传输模式和数据传输的类型。该传输模式被归类为单工,半双工和全双工。每种传输模式都有一个源(也称为发送器)和目的地(也称为接收器)。

5fb7c77f02a2dc07a70980847795a63f.png

数据传输可以通过两种方式进行。它们是串行通信和并行通信。

串行通信是一种使用双线即发送器(发送器)和接收器逐位发送数据的技术。使用类似技术的通讯产品包括串口服务器,以太网模块等产品。

例如,我想从发送器向接收器发送8位二进制数据11001110。但是,哪一点首先消失?最高有效位 - MSB(第 7 位)或最低有效位 - LSB(第 0 位)。我们不能说。在这里,我正在考虑LSB首先移动(对于小Endian)。

并行通信一次移动8,16或32位数据。打印机和Xerox机器使用并行通信来加快数据传输速度。

1c80cb8f5868ad98f9ae07c788761a31.png

串行和并行通信之间的区别

串行通信一次只发送一位。因此,这些需要更少的I / O(输入 - 输出)线。因此,占用更少的空间并且更能抵抗串扰。串行通信的主要优点是整个嵌入式系统的成本变得便宜并且可以长距离传输信息。串行传输用于DCE(数据通信设备)设备,如调制解调器。

5cd4defb951de1f198ed3a6a893f6ae5.png

在并行通信中,一次发送一块数据(8,16或32位)。因此,每个数据位都需要一个单独的物理I / O线。并行通信的优点是速度快但缺点是它使用了更多的I / O(输入 - 输出)线。并行传输用于PC(个人计算机),用于互连CPU(中央处理单元),RAM(随机存取存储器),调制解调器,音频,视频和网络硬件。

注意:如果您的集成电路或处理器支持较少量的输入/输出引脚,则最好选择串行通信。

b9f1a6d2b8bc3030e0d08fd971725de3.png

时钟同步

为了有效地处理串行设备,时钟是主要来源。时钟故障可能导致意外结果。每个串行设备的时钟信号不同,它分为同步协议和异步协议。

同步串行接口

同步串行接口上的所有设备都使用单CPU总线来共享时钟和数据。由于这个事实,数据传输更快。优点是波特率不会失配。此外,接口组件需要更少的I / O(输入 - 输出)线。例如I2C,SPI等。

f4eaf4a84b774a91dd1ba933e3d190ef.png

异步串行接口

该异步接口不具有外部时钟信号,并将其即依赖于四个参数

1.波特率控制

2.数据流控制

3.传输和接收控制

4.错误控制。

异步协议适用于稳定通信。这些用于长距离应用。异步协议的示例是RS-232,RS-422和RS-485。

6d01c6ee025bbdb5aed0dde0cea53bb1.png

好了,以上内容就是帝特电子关于串行通信和并行通信的区别的详细介绍,希望能对大家有所帮助!感谢您的阅读与支持,欢迎关注与留言!

您可能感兴趣的与本文相关的镜像

GPT-SoVITS

GPT-SoVITS

AI应用

GPT-SoVITS 是一个开源的文本到语音(TTS)和语音转换模型,它结合了 GPT 的生成能力和 SoVITS 的语音转换技术。该项目以其强大的声音克隆能力而闻名,仅需少量语音样本(如5秒)即可实现高质量的即时语音合成,也可通过更长的音频(如1分钟)进行微调以获得更逼真的效果

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值